Step-by-Step Fix for Syncing Issues
If you’re experiencing difficulties syncing your garage door opener with your BMW, you’re not alone. Many users encounter similar issues that can stem from various factors. This section provides a detailed, step-by-step guide to help you troubleshoot and resolve these syncing problems effectively.
Follow these steps to troubleshoot and fix the syncing issue between your BMW and garage door opener. Ensure you have the owner’s manual for both devices on hand.
Check compatibility
Verify that your garage door opener is compatible with your BMW model. Consult the manuals for both devices.Clear previous settings
If the opener has been programmed before, clear any existing settings. Refer to the garage door opener manual for specific instructions.Enter programming mode
Activate programming mode on your garage door opener. This usually involves pressing a specific button or combination of buttons.Program the BMW
In your BMW, press the button you wish to use for the opener. Hold it until the indicator light blinks, then release it. Press the button again until the light stays on.Test the opener
After programming, test the garage door opener by pressing the assigned button in your BMW. If it doesn’t work, repeat the programming steps.

Identifying and Resolving Signal Interference
When attempting to sync a garage door opener with your BMW, signal interference can often be the culprit behind connectivity issues. Understanding the various sources of interference and how to identify them is essential for a successful resolution. This section will guide you through common obstacles and provide practical solutions to enhance your syncing experience.
Signal interference can disrupt the syncing process. If you suspect interference, try the following:
Move closer to the garage door opener during programming.
Turn off nearby devices that may emit signals, such as Wi-Fi routers or cordless phones.
